Michelada

2 oz. Clamato juice (tomato juice with clam juice and delicious seasonings)
Juice of 1 Lime (roughly 1 oz.)
2 – 3 dashes of Worcestershire sauce
12 oz. beer of choice (MyHusband prefers Dos Equis)
Tajin
Lime wedge for garnish
- Rim pint glass with Tajin.
- Pour Clamato juice, lime juice, and Worcestershire sauce into glass.
- Slowly pour in beer.
- Garnish with lime wedge.
- Enjoy.
Casa Bella

1 oz. tequila
1 oz. lime juice
½ oz. agave nectar
4 oz. prosecco
Tajin
Lime wedge
- Rim glass with Tajin.
- Pour tequila, lime juice, and agave into glass.
- Slowly top with prosecco.
- Garnish with lime wedge.
- Enjoy.
Italian Soda

½ oz. limoncello
1 oz. lemon vodka
1 oz. lemon juice
½ oz. basil simple syrup
Club soda
1 fresh basil leaf
1 lemon wedge
- Pour limoncello, vodka, lemon juice, and simple syrup into glass.
- Slap or snap basil leaf and add to glass.
- Slowly top with club soda.
- Garnish with lemon wedge.
- Enjoy.

Vodka Sunrise
1 oz. vodka
6 oz. orange juice
1 oz. grenadine syrup
- Pour vodka into glass.
- Add orange juice.
- Top with granadine.
- Enjoy!
